If you're using an SBS with SP1 upgraded from SP0, you should follow these
steps to reinstall SharePoint Companyweb.

1. Please strictly follow KB 829114 for reinstallation of SharePoint
companyweb (with SBS 2003 SP0 CD3 inserted).

2. If the system prompts you for SP1 installation CD3, follow these steps:

a) Open Registry Editor and set 'isrunfromweb' to '2', under
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\SmallBusinessServer.

b) Download SBS 2003 SP1 (885918) to C:\.

c) Open CMD window and type "C:\SBS2003-KB885918-SP1-X86-ENU.EXE /x" (with
no quotation marks) and press Enter.

d) Specifying a path for the extracted files (such as C:\SBSSP1).

e) Point the system to the folder created in the previous steps
(C:\SBSSP1\CD3).

3. After finish the installation, install KB 832880.

More information:

832880 You cannot successfully install the intranet component or connect
to http://companyweb in Windows Small Business Server 2003

http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;EN-US;832880

4. Install WSS 2.0 SP1.

5. Install SBS 2003 SP1 again.

6. Reboot the server and check whether the problem persists.
